Ondangwa gears up to host 11th trade expo

THE Ondangwa Town Council has announced that plans are in place to host the 11th trade exhibition from 30 April to 4 May at the Ondangwa Trade and Industrial Exhibition Centre.

This year’s trade exhibition is said to be filled with an exciting line-up of activities and networking opportunities designed to facilitate meaningful connections and partnerships.

Town council spokesperson Petrina Shitalangaho-Mutikisha says this event marks a significant milestone in its commitment to fostering innovation, collaboration and business growth within the corporate and business community.

“This is the 11th time council is hosting this annual exhibition. The exhibition is expected to bring together leading experts, industry pioneers and key stakeholders from around the country.”

She says the trade exhibition will serve as a platform for networking, knowledge sharing and exploring emerging trends and technologies shaping the future of local economies.

Shitalangaho-Mutikisha adds that attendees can anticipate an impactful experience featuring an exhibition hall showcasing the latest products, services and solutions-based technologies from top companies and start-ups.

“As a host, we are excited and committed to ensuring a safe and inclusive environment for all participants (exhibitors and visitors).

“We are thrilled to present this opportunity once again and to be hosting this prestigious exhibition, bringing together the best and brightest minds in various disciplines.”
